How To Be A Bratty Over Text

Let's face it, being a little bratty over text can be fun and entertaining, especially when you're in a lighthearted and playful mood. It's a way to tease your friends and family, and add some humor to your conversations. With the rise of social media and messaging apps, it's easier than ever to be a little sassy and playful over text.
One of the best ways to be bratty over text is to use emotions and emojis to add tone and personality to your messages. For example, you can use the eye-roll emoji to express frustration or annoyance, or the smiling face emoji to show that you're just joking around. By using these visual aids, you can convey your tone and attitude in a way that's hard to do with just words.

The Art of Teasing
One of the most important things to remember when being bratty over text is to know when to stop. While it's fun to tease and playfully annoy your friends and family, you don't want to cross the line and actually hurt or offend someone. By being considerate and respectful, you can ensure that your bratty behavior is seen as fun and playful, rather than mean-spirited or hurtful.

Another thing to keep in mind when being bratty over text is to be mindful of your audience. While your friends and family may appreciate your bratty sense of humor, not everyone may find it amusing. By being considerate of your audience and tuning in to their vibe, you can avoid offending or alienating anyone, and keep the conversation fun and inclusive for everyone.
